aboutsummaryrefslogtreecommitdiff
path: root/contrib/intarray/_int_gist.c
diff options
context:
space:
mode:
authorTeodor Sigaev <teodor@sigaev.ru>2006-04-03 08:37:41 +0000
committerTeodor Sigaev <teodor@sigaev.ru>2006-04-03 08:37:41 +0000
commitcdfecf6e3ee62a8774dbd16aea275570595c81eb (patch)
tree5899da3b97b16916509feffea8c536755dd5f3dd /contrib/intarray/_int_gist.c
parent7f129956e16e74460fc47dd89c174ca232bfd1b6 (diff)
downloadpostgresql-cdfecf6e3ee62a8774dbd16aea275570595c81eb.tar.gz
postgresql-cdfecf6e3ee62a8774dbd16aea275570595c81eb.zip
Minor cleanups
Diffstat (limited to 'contrib/intarray/_int_gist.c')
-rw-r--r--contrib/intarray/_int_gist.c4
1 files changed, 3 insertions, 1 deletions
diff --git a/contrib/intarray/_int_gist.c b/contrib/intarray/_int_gist.c
index e8cf24fe47b..e2f1225d2c3 100644
--- a/contrib/intarray/_int_gist.c
+++ b/contrib/intarray/_int_gist.c
@@ -47,8 +47,10 @@ g_int_consistent(PG_FUNCTION_ARGS)
/* sort query for fast search, key is already sorted */
CHECKARRVALID(query);
- if (ARRISVOID(query))
+ if (ARRISVOID(query)) {
+ pfree( query );
PG_RETURN_BOOL(false);
+ }
PREPAREARR(query);
switch (strategy)